Biological Approach
A perspective in psychology and medicine focusing on biological and genetic factors to understand human behavior and diseases, emphasizing the importance of the body's biological systems.
Residential Colleges
Institutions that combine housing and education, offering students a community where they live and learn together.
Total Institutions
Institutions such as prisons, military, or mental hospitals, where all aspects of a person's life are controlled under a single authority, often leading to effects on individual identity and autonomy.
Medical Model
A framework for understanding health and illness that emphasizes biological factors and views treatment through medical intervention.
